9M viewers is the goal for Rousey for Netflix event

May 14, 2026 by Jason Cruz Leave a Comment

It is fight week for Most Valuable Promotions MMA event on Netflix. Ronda Rousey takes on Gina Carano this Saturday and during media rounds Rousey has a goal for the event.

Rousey wants to beat the 8.8 million viewers that watched Junior Dos Santos face Cain Velasquez on Fox in 2011. The fight, which lasted about a minute drew nearly 9 million viewers for the first-ever network event for the UFC.

Obviously, the return to MMA for Rousey has brought back her competitiveness. On Wednesday she indicated that her goal was to have the most watched fight in MMA history.

Rousey has been making the media rounds and its clear that she wants to make this event bigger than any that the UFC has put on. While she admits that it’s nothing personal with Dana White, she is taking it personal with Hunter Campbell.
